Ran into this issue as well on Windows 7.  File my return last month no problem, and now working on another family members.  Software updated last night, and crashes at the same screen as everyone else - Do you have another W2 to enter.

 

Right-clicking the shortcut for TurboTax 2019 and selecting "Troubleshoot Compatibility" was the fix as well.  Follow the steps.  In my case I select that none of the issues applied, and then chose Windows XP SP2 to match the screenshot provided by wutexit.

 

After that, no problem.  Good luck everybody.

After you get the program installed the first thing to do before you open your tax return is to update the program and install any state programs you had. Then open your file. So you first might need to start a fake return to be able to download the state program (go to FILE - NEW TAX RETURN)

 

Then go to FILE -Open and find your return.

In case anyone cares, here is the crash details trying to work on existing Real Estate entry.

 

Problem signature:
Problem Event Name: APPCRASH
Application Name: TurboTax.exe
Application Version: 2019.41.30.244
Application Timestamp: 5eba5031
Fault Module Name: clr.dll
Fault Module Version: 4.8.4069.0
Fault Module Timestamp: 5dc61560
Exception Code: 80131506
Exception Offset: 003196d6
OS Version: 6.1.7601.2.1.0.256.48
Locale ID: 1033
Additional Information 1: a0f4
Additional Information 2: a0f4dc82a0b7844ae73b4189298bce4d
Additional Information 3: d0a6
Additional Information 4: d0a6e268560759ba03f4c0f4d8f2479a

 

I am finding a pattern to the crashes. As the application tries to open up the forms for a new area, it exits. Based upon past experience, there could be a few causes:

- updated version  not able to read new form versions 

- updated code can not read old forms

 

 I have now reproduced the issue reliably 100% with specific forms while other forms work fine 100%. That implies there is not a general application failure or an incompatibility with the system. I should also note that I accessed those same forms (both crashing and working) several times the past few days without incident until the software update installed today.
